thirdgen wrote:Never wrapped my previous cars no problems at all.

.......

wrapping cuts down a hell of a lot of heat in the engine bay. better for all components
(and stops your wiring burning out and shorting out on your professionally fitted headers)
also keeps heat in which improves gas flow and performance
